Will getting my cat neutered stop him from urinating on the furniture and floors?

It certainly might. Urine marking is a normal and expected behavior for intact males, so neutering is one of the first things we recommend if your cat is doing this. The earlier it's done, the better - this is because the longer this behavior continues, the more it will become a habit that may not resolve after the neuter. It's important to realize that urine marking can also be related to stress or anxiety, so if this is the case, these issues would also need to be addressed in order to resolve the behavior.
